How long does threadlocker red take to dry?

Threadlocker red typically takes about 24 hours to fully cure at room temperature. However, it can begin to set within a few minutes after application. The drying time may vary depending on factors such as temperature, humidity, and the specific formulation of the threadlocker. For best results, it's advisable to allow a full 24 hours before subjecting the bonded parts to any significant stress.

What is flucozanole?

Fluconazole is an antifungal medication used to treat a variety of fungal infections, including those caused by Candida species and certain types of meningitis. It works by inhibiting the synthesis of ergosterol, an essential component of fungal cell membranes, leading to cell death. Fluconazole is commonly prescribed in oral and intravenous forms and is effective in treating infections in both immunocompromised and healthy individuals. It is important to use this medication under the guidance of a healthcare professional due to potential side effects and drug interactions.

What is coprophiba?

Coprophobia is an intense fear or aversion to feces or anything associated with feces. This anxiety disorder can lead individuals to avoid situations or places where they might encounter feces, causing significant distress. Like other specific phobias, it may stem from traumatic experiences or learned behaviors. Treatment options often include therapy,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y, to help manage and reduce the fear.

What is hydropohbia?

Hydrophobia, often associated with rabies, is an intense fear of water that can manifest in both psychological and physical symptoms. In the context of rabies, it refers to the difficulty or inability to swallow water, leading to panic and distress. This condition reflects the severe neurological effects of the rabies virus. Additionally, hydrophobia can also refer to a general fear of water, which is classified as a specific phobia.

What is piolgin?

Pioglitazone is an oral medication used to manage type 2 diabetes. It belongs to the class of drugs known as thiazolidinediones, which work by improving insulin sensitivity and helping the body use glucose more effectively. Pioglitazone can be prescribed alone or in combination with other diabetes medications. Like all medications, it may have side effects and should be taken under the guidance of a healthcare professional.
